Leaving a tree stump in your garden can lead to several problems over time. One of the most common issues is safety. Tree stumps can become tripping hazards, especially in areas where children play or where there is frequent foot traffic. In addition, hidden roots can make mowing or landscaping difficult, increasing the risk of accidents or equipment damage. Removing stumps ensures a safer and more accessible outdoor environment.
Another major concern is pest infestation. Decaying stumps can attract insects such as termites, ants, and beetles, which may eventually spread to nearby plants or even your home. Fungal growth is also common in rotting wood, which can negatively affect surrounding vegetation. Professional stump removal eliminates these risks, helping to maintain a healthy garden ecosystem.
Stumps can also impact the aesthetic appeal of your property. A well-maintained garden can lose its charm when unsightly stumps are left behind. Removing them creates a clean, polished look, enhancing the overall appearance of your landscape. This is especially important for homeowners looking to improve curb appeal or prepare their property for sale.
Furthermore, stumps can lead to unwanted regrowth if not properly removed. Some tree species can sprout new shoots from the remaining stump, resulting in multiple small trees that are difficult to manage. Stump grinding and removal prevent this issue, ensuring that the tree does not grow back and allowing you to fully utilize your space.
